#78bf7e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#78bf7e is composed of 47.1% red, 74.9% green and 49.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 34% yellow and 25.1% black. It has a hue angle of 125.1 degrees, a saturation of 35.7% and a lightness of 61%. #78bf7e color hex could be obtained by blending #f0fffc with #007f00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#78bf7e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050b06 is the darkest color, while #fdfefd is the lightest one.
